Output efdf0a6fad9b303eca47280039efa33afffcaa0156582debd144f047cd850a1a:67

value
14348907
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 27d18447437cbb85d70f37fc8827c3b886dd252dff01e00a8cb2757f71856a58
address
bc1pylgcg36r0jact4c0xl7gsf7rhzrd6ffdluq7qz5vkf6h7uv9dfvqyka6ps
transaction
efdf0a6fad9b303eca47280039efa33afffcaa0156582debd144f047cd850a1a
confirmations
74969
spent
true